Vulko-Wrap™ is A TPC’s popular self-vulcanizing insulating wrap. Made of a specially compounded, synthetic silicone elastomer, this tape is resistant to oil, water, ozone and many chemicals. It has a high dielectric strength and is completely safe to use on all electrical connections.

Stainless Steel Connectors - Military Class E; Proprietary (ZZY, ZZW) • Machined from 300-series stainless steel providing superior strength and wear characteristics • Threaded or bayonet coupling • Shells experience a less than 10% loss in yield strength at elevated temperatures, 204°C (399°F)

High Power Connector with Safety Design, derived from MIL-DTL-38999. Amphenol’s PowerSafe MIL-DTL-38999 Series III High Power Connector uses first mate/last break and last mate/first break technology and is designed for transmitting high power with voltages up to 500V in harsh environments, all while keeping user safety in mind.

AC Threaded This series, meeting applicable requirements of SAE AS50151 and up to 250 amps possible with optional RADSOK® socket contacts is a general duty or ruggedized harsh environment, metal, threaded coupling, power, and signal connector.

ICP ® accelerometers are AC coupled devices and will not measure or respond to uniform acceleration (also known as static or DC acceleration). Capacitance and resistance values internal to the accelerometer set the discharge time constant (DTC) and low frequency response.
